Excel数据转数据库一列怎么做?快速转换技巧详解
将Excel数据转换为一列数据库,核心要点有:1、选择合适的工具或平台(如简道云零代码开发平台);2、清洗与规范化数据;3、进行结构化导入;4、校验与后续管理。其中,选择合适的工具尤为关键。以简道云零代码开发平台为例,其无需编写代码即可实现快速部署数据库表结构和数据导入,极大地降低了非技术人员的数据管理门槛。用户仅需上传Excel文件,经过字段映射和格式校验后,即可自动生成一列式数据库,实现数据的高效整合与后续应用。此外,该平台还支持在线协作、权限控制和自动化流程,为企业数字化转型提供了一站式解决方案。👉简道云零代码开发平台官网地址
《如何把excel数据变成一列数据库》
一、什么是“把Excel数据变成一列数据库”?
- “把Excel数据变成一列数据库”通常指的是:将原本存储在Excel表格中的多维或多列数据,以结构化、一维(单列表)的方式迁移到专业数据库系统中,以便于数据统一管理、查询分析和多系统协作。
- 这种转化不仅提升了数据标准化水平,同时便于与其他业务系统集成,实现更高效的数据流转。
主要场景举例
| 场景 | 说明 |
|---|---|
| 客户信息整合 | 将分散在多个Excel表的客户资料集中到数据库的一列中 |
| 产品编码归档 | 将不同部门维护的产品编码集中处理 |
| 问卷调查结果处理 | 多人填写的问卷结果归并为标准库便于分析 |
二、主要步骤拆解与流程说明
一般操作流程可以分为以下几个核心步骤:
- 选择适用工具/平台(如简道云零代码开发平台)
- 清洗并规范Excel原始数据
- 设计目标数据库结构
- 执行导入及字段映射
- 校验及后续优化
步骤详解
| 步骤 | 操作要点 |
|---|---|
| 1. 工具选择 | 建议优先选用0代码可视化平台,如简道云,可省去复杂脚本处理 |
| 2. 数据清洗 | 检查空值、重复项、不一致格式等问题,保持内容规范 |
| 3. 结构设计 | 明确需要导入哪些字段,一列式展示时注意主键唯一性或索引设置 |
| 4. 导入映射 | 使用平台的数据导入功能,将表头与目标库字段逐项匹配 |
| 5. 验证优化 | 检查导入后的完整性、一致性,可加设自动校正或提醒机制 |
三、使用简道云零代码开发平台实现全流程操作详解
为什么推荐简道云?
- 简道云是国内领先的零代码应用搭建服务商。无需任何编程基础,通过拖拽组件即可创建自定义数据表单和业务流,更适用于企业快速搭建内部管理系统。
- 平台支持从Excel批量导入,并能灵活配置单列表模式及后续的数据权限、安全策略等。
实操详细步骤
- 注册并登录简道云官网;
- 新建一个应用,在应用下新建“数据表”,设置为“一列”模式;
- 点击“批量导入”,上传准备好的Excel文档;
- 系统会自动识别字段,用户可手动调整字段映射关系(如名称→name等);
- 启动校验功能,检查是否存在重复或非法内容,并进行修正提示;
- 一键完成导入,所有内容整齐排列于同一列,可直接在界面检索和维护;
- 配置权限,如谁可以查看/编辑该库内容,以及自动通知流程等。
部分界面操作示意
| 操作环节 | 简要说明 |
|---|---|
| 登录注册 | 使用手机号/邮箱快速注册,无需繁琐验证 |
| 应用创建 | “新建应用”→“添加新表”→命名并勾选“一列表结构” |
| 批量上传 | 支持.xls/.xlsx格式,一步完成文件到库的转换 |
四、“一列表”模式下常见问题及解决办法
常见问题
- Excel原始内容有多行多列,但目标库只需保留某个关键字段
- 导入过程中出现乱码或格式错乱
- 不同来源的数据有重名或冲突
- 导入量大时速度慢
对策建议
- 优先进行内容筛选,只保留关键列再做转换。
- 简道云内置字符编码自适应,不易出现乱码,如遇特殊符号建议统一替换。
- 平台支持主键冲突检测,可启用去重逻辑(如手机号/ID唯一)。
- 云端批量处理能力强,无须担心性能瓶颈。
问题对照表
| 出现情形 | 推荐操作 |
|---|---|
| 字段太多 | 删除无关字段,仅保留需“一列表”的部分 |
| 格式不规范 | 在Excel内预处理(文本型/数值型统一) |
| 重复冗余 | 利用系统去重功能 |
五、“一列表”数据库带来的价值与应用场景拓展
优势总结
- 数据一致性更强——避免多人手工录入带来的冗余
- 查询检索效率高——通过唯一索引可秒级定位目标条目
- 易于扩展——未来若需升级为多维度、多条件查询,仅需增添相关字段即可
- 自动化集成——可随时对接OA、人事CRM等其他业务系统,实现全链路数字流通
实例说明
以HR部门维护员工工号名单为例: 过去每月都要人工比对多个部门上报名单,有遗漏难以追溯。采用简道云后,全员名单由各部门直接在线上补充至同一个“一列表”,实时同步组织架构,无缝对接考勤、人事合同模块,大幅提升准确率和工作效率。
六、安全性与权限管理实践指南
在企业级场景下,一列表数据库常涉及敏感信息,因此务必做好安全隔离与访问控制:
- 利用简道云提供的子账号功能,为不同角色分配只读/编辑权限
- 可设定审批流,如新增条目须经主管审核方可生效
- 系统后台具备日志追踪能力,对所有增删改查行为透明记录,有助于审计合规
- 支持定期备份恢复机制,应对误删除等风险
七、将“一列表”进一步升级,多元运营赋能示范方案
由于大多数业务初期只关注少量核心信息,但随着需求变化,经常需要追加更多属性(如交易明细、联系记录等)。建议:
- 在初步建库阶段就预留扩展位(即空白辅助字段)
- 定期梳理业务需求,由管理员统一增补新栏位,无须重新迁移历史数据
- 利用API接口,将该库同步至第三方ERP/CRM/BI报表系统,实现全渠道贯通运营分析
升级演进路径示意图
Excel原始 -> 一列表标准库 -> 多属性动态扩展 -> 全员在线协作 -> 综合业务集成八、常见误区及专家建议汇总答疑
常见误区
- 忽视前期格式清洗,导致后端报错频发
- 人工逐行复制粘贴,浪费大量时间且易出错
- 没有设置唯一标识码,日后难以排查异常
专家建议
- 强烈推荐利用专业0代码平台一次性批量处理所有历史遗留文件;
- 设置自定义校验规则,例如手机号格式判别等,提高录入质量;
- 启动通知提醒功能,让相关人员及时知晓每次更新;
总结与行动建议
综上所述,把Excel数据变成一列数据库,不仅是技术上的简单迁移,更是提升企业数字治理水平的重要基础。通过借助像简道云零代码开发平台这样的低门槛工具,可以极大提高效率、安全性和可扩展性。建议用户根据实际需求提前规划好目标结构,并养成定期梳理优化习惯。如果您希望一步到位体验更多成熟企业管理模板,也可以免费试用:
100+企业管理系统模板免费使用>>>无需下载,在线安装: https://s.fanruan.com/l0cac
精品问答:
如何将Excel中的多列数据转换成数据库中的一列?
我手头有一个Excel表格,里面有多列数据,我想把这些数据合并成数据库中的一列,但不知道具体操作步骤和注意事项是什么。有没有简单有效的方法?
要将Excel中的多列数据转换为数据库中的一列,可以通过以下步骤实现:
- 在Excel中使用“合并单元格”或“&”符号进行数据合并,比如使用公式 =A2 & ”,” & B2 & ”,” & C2 将多列拼接。
- 利用Excel的“Power Query”功能,将多列转为一列表格,操作简单且高效。
- 导出处理后的Excel文件为CSV格式,便于导入数据库。
- 使用SQL的INSERT语句将CSV数据导入目标数据库的一列。
例如,使用Power Query的“取消透视”功能,可以快速将多列表格转换成单列表格,提升工作效率。根据统计,使用Power Query能节省30%以上的数据预处理时间。
为什么要用Power Query来把Excel多列数据转成数据库的一列?
我听说Power Query可以处理复杂的数据转换,但不太明白它具体是怎样帮助我把Excel的多列数据变成数据库中的一列,是不是比传统方法更好?
Power Query是微软提供的强大ETL工具,可直接在Excel中进行数据提取、转换和加载。相比传统手动复制粘贴或公式合并,Power Query支持批量自动化处理,并且流程可重复执行,大幅减少人为错误。
优势包括:
- 支持‘取消透视’功能,将多列表转成长格式单列表;
- 兼容各种数据源,方便后续导入数据库;
- 提供可视化界面,无需编程基础;
例如,一家财务公司使用Power Query对5000行、多达10列的数据进行转换,仅用时5分钟,而传统方法需30分钟以上,提高效率超80%。
如何通过SQL语句将从Excel导出的单列表CSV文件导入数据库?
我已经把Excel的数据处理成了一列表格,并保存为CSV格式,现在想知道怎么用SQL语句把这些CSV文件准确导入到数据库里?需要注意什么呢?
导入CSV文件到数据库通常用以下SQL方式:
- 使用LOAD DATA INFILE(MySQL示例):
LOAD DATA INFILE 'path/to/file.csv'INTO TABLE table_nameFIELDS TERMINATED BY ','ENCLOSED BY '"'LINES TERMINATED BY '\n'(column_name);- 对于其他数据库(如PostgreSQL),可用COPY命令:
COPY table_name(column_name) FROM 'path/to/file.csv' DELIMITER ',' CSV HEADER;- 注意事项:确保CSV编码格式兼容、字段分隔符正确、表结构与CSV字段对应一致。
案例数据显示,在正确配置参数后,批量导入速度可达每秒万条记录,有效支持大规模数据迁移。
有没有简单的方法在不写代码的情况下,把Excel多栏数据变成数据库一栏?
我不是技术人员,不熟悉编程和SQL,我希望能找到一种不需要写代码的方法,把我的Excel中多个栏位的数据合并成一个栏位,然后放进我的数据库里,这样做方便吗?
对于非技术用户,可以采用以下无代码方案:
- Excel内置功能:“Power Query”的‘取消透视’操作,只需点击菜单选项即可完成;
- 使用第三方工具如‘DBConvert’或者‘Hevo Data’,支持拖拽式界面,实现从Excel到数据库的一键同步;
- 利用在线平台(如Airtable)先做整合,再连接到主流关系型数据库。
例如,通过Power Query,只需5步点击操作即可完成,从而避免手动复制粘贴带来的错误,同时提高了工作效率与准确性。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/89764/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。